The image presents a detailed view of a cicada's dorsal side, showcasing its green coloration and distinctive features.
**Key Features:**
* **Body Color:** The cicada has a vibrant green color.
* **Wings:** Its wings are transparent with black veins that can be seen through the wings.
* **Eyes:** The eyes appear to be quite large in proportion to the rest of its body, with a shiny black appearance and distinctive markings.
**Overall Appearance:**
The image provides an intimate view of the cicada's dorsal side, highlighting its unique coloration and features. – AI vision
